Introduction

The Iron Dome is a missile defense system designed to intercept and destroy short-range rockets and artillery shells fired from distances of 4 to 70 kilometers away.

How Does Iron Dome Work?

The system uses detection and tracking radar, which locates the incoming threats. Once identified, the system launches interceptor missiles to destroy the target in mid-air.

Case Study: Israel

Israel has been a prominent user of the Iron Dome system, successfully intercepting over 90% of rockets fired towards populated areas.

Statistics

According to reports, Iron Dome has intercepted over 2,500 rockets since its deployment in 2011.
